Description
The Peg Maze is a simple yet highly educational Montessori-inspired toy that is perfect for helping your child develop their perseverance, creative problem-solving skills, and spatial awareness. Crafted from sustainably sourced wood, this high-quality toy features a dowel centered on a wooden base with 3 primary colored square plates that have complex hole patterns cut into them. The child must manipulate the puzzle pieces in different directions to navigate the maze and guide the dowel all the way down to the plate.
This fun and engaging puzzle offers more than just entertainment for your little one. It also provides a valuable opportunity for them to develop their fine motor skills while exercising their brains. As your child works to solve the puzzle, they'll gain a sense of satisfaction and accomplishment that will help build their confidence and self-esteem.

Materials & Care
Materials
FSC-certified wood with 100% non-toxic water-based stain and finish.
Care:
Wipe with a damp cloth and mild soap, then wipe with a clean damp cloth. Dry immediately. Do not submerge in water or have prolonged contact with liquids.
